White Porcelain Janggun [Horizontal] Jar

unknownJoseon, 16th century

Gyeonggi Province Museum

Gyeonggi Province Museum
Yongin-si, South Korea

The jar has bluish-white porcelain glaze evenly applied all over the body. Jars shaped like this were made only in the early Joseon Period and used mostly to contain liquid. This one is presumed to have been made in a kiln in Gwangju, Gyeonggi-do in the early 16th century.
